Transaction 24272fe5017fb110b656f2d023db73d89cf3232571f651e2fa17510875b65e91

1 Input
2 Outputs
  • 24272fe5017fb110b656f2d023db73d89cf3232571f651e2fa17510875b65e91:0
  • value  17610637
    address  1AGYU5G3yL6hZiVyZJScadsNfrCtPbMUEa
  • 24272fe5017fb110b656f2d023db73d89cf3232571f651e2fa17510875b65e91:1
  • value  123831214
    address  3MudGQR3xM35ePYxDe9BQCsssyQSZtc61H